Chain-of-Thought May Not Be a Window into AI’s Reasoning: Anthropic’s New...

Chain-of-thought (CoT) prompting has become a popular method for improving and interpreting the reasoning processes of large language models (LLMs). The idea is simple: if a model explains its answer step-by-step, then those steps should give us some insight into how it reached its conclusion. This is especially appealing...
